20 Short Science Fiction Stories Various 20 Short Science Fiction Stories is a collection of classic sci-fi tales exploring themes like space exploration, time travel, artificial intelligence, and human nature. Stories such as The Skull and The Man from Time deal with time paradoxes, while The Defenders and Second Variety examine the consequences of war and AI. The Eyes Have It adds humor with a misunderstanding of language, and The Crystal Crypt delivers a suspenseful mystery. From dystopian futures to alien encounters, these stories challenge perception, ethics, and survival in imaginative and thought-provoking ways. Summary by Dream AudioBooks.
